What Are Betting Lines?

At its core, a betting line is a number set by bookmakers to indicate the expected outcome of a sporting event. These lines help bettors understand where to place their bets and predict the results of games and matches.

Types of Betting Lines

Understanding the different types of betting lines is crucial for anyone looking to dive into sports betting. The primary types include:

  • Point Spread: This line involves a calculated margin of victory set by bookmakers. For example, if a team is favored to win by 7 points, they must win by more than 7 for a bet on them to pay out.
  • Moneyline: This type refers to the odds set by the bookmaker on each team winning the game. It is straightforward and allows bettors to win based purely on which team wins, regardless of the score.
  • Over/Under (Totals): This line calculates a combined score of both teams and allows bettors to wager whether the total score will be over or under that number. It adds another layer of strategy to betting.
  • Prop Bets: These lines allow wagering on specific events within a game, such as which player will score first or how many yards a quarterback will throw.

How Betting Lines Are Set

Bookmakers utilize various factors to set betting lines, including:

  • Statistical Analysis: Bookmakers analyze historical data and team statistics to determine the likelihood of certain outcomes.
  • Public Perception: Bookmakers also take into account how the public perceives a team, adjusting lines based on betting patterns to ensure balanced action on both sides.
  • Injury Reports: Critical information regarding player injuries can greatly affect team performance expectations and hence the betting lines.
  • Weather Conditions: For outdoor sports, weather can play a significant role in the outcome of games, which is factored into the lines.

The Importance of Line Movement

Tracking the movement of betting lines is essential for serious bettors. Line movement can indicate how the market views the game and can often lead to insights about the probable outcomes:

  • Sharp Money: When professional bettors place large bets on one side, the line may shift, indicating a perceived edge.
  • Injury Updates: Late-breaking news about player injuries can lead to rapid adjustments in betting lines.
  • Public Betting Trends: If a significant amount of money is wagered on one team, bookmakers will adjust the line to mitigate risk.

Strategies for Betting on Sports

To improve your chances of winning when you're dealing with betting lines for sports, consider the following strategies:

  • Do Your Research: Knowledge is power. Research teams, players, and matchups to make informed decisions.
  • Shop for Lines: Different sportsbooks may offer varying lines for the same game. Shopping around can help you find the best odds.
  • Bankroll Management: Have a clear strategy regarding how much money you are willing to risk and stick to it.
  • Stay Objective: Keep emotions in check and avoid betting on your favorite teams just out of loyalty.
  • Utilize Advanced Statistics: Advanced metrics can offer deeper insights than traditional statistics, providing an edge in your betting decisions.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Betting on sports can be exciting, but there are pitfalls to be aware of:

  • Chasing Losses: Many bettors fall into the trap of trying to win back lost money by making riskier bets. This can lead to significant losses.
  • Ignoring Bankroll Management: Not managing your betting bankroll can result in carelessness and poor decision-making.
  • Betting Out of Emotion: Allowing emotions to dictate betting decisions can lead to poor outcomes. Always bet with a clear mind.
  • Neglecting Research: Betting without doing adequate research can lead to uninformed decisions, which are rarely successful.
